QUOTE(Ares187 @ Nov 12 2016, 06:39 AM)
Any one bought a wireless headphones apart from the earpods ? i am thinking of getting the
Jabra ROX Wireless Bluetooth Stereo Earbuds , right now its rm 274 at Lazada after discount . RRP is rm 549 . With 2 years warranty .

http://www.lazada.com.my/jabra-rox-wireles...ty-1775558.html
*
I've been using this. Sound quality is great, though you just need to test all the wings + earbuds to get the right fit for your ears. (if the fitting isn't right the sound will be very meh)

Minor cons are that the wings will help the earphone stay put while jogging but after awhile it will start to make your ears sore. Also because the headset is magnetic and the finishing is brushed metal, after awhile the finishing will start to rub off.

But for the price this is a really good buy biggrin.gif
